Five signals. One surface.
Instrumented for vendor-neutrality. Whether you're on Kubernetes, VMs, or a hybrid estate, the signals share labels, correlation IDs, and dashboards — because fragmentation is where incidents hide.
Horizontally scalable, long-retention metrics with SLO-based alerting and multi-cluster global query.
Structured, label-indexed log aggregation that scales without the retention tax of legacy log tools.
Distributed tracing from ingress through every hop, with one correlation ID that survives service boundaries.
Continuous CPU, heap, and goroutine profiling that pinpoints regressions to the exact function.
Runtime, network, and admission-time security events on the same pane as reliability signals.

Every request carries a correlation ID through every hop. Every dashboard pivots to the underlying trace or log line in one click. Alerts fire on SLO burn, not thresholds copied from a runbook nobody maintains.
Runtime, network, and admission-time security events land in the same pane as reliability signals. Detections are mapped to MITRE ATT&CK and enriched with the same identity and workload context the platform team already curates.
